CollinsKiprop Kipngok

  • position Distance/XC
  • class Sophomore
  • Hometown Nakuru, Kenya

In the Record Books:

  • Holds the UK school record in the men’s 3000m steeplechase with an 8:22.67 mark, set in 2025
  • Ranks 8th all-time in the indoor mile with a 4:00.27 time, set in 2025
  • Ranks 3rd all-time in the indoor 3000m with a 7:55.30 time, set in 2025
  • Ranks fourth all-time in the indoor 5000m with a 13:58.61 time, set in 2025

2024-25 (Freshman)

Outdoor

  • Won the SEC men’s 3000m steeplechase Championship, breaking the meet and facility record with a time of 8:26.33
  • Broke the UK 3000m steeplechase record his outdoor debut at the Stanford Invitational, placing second in the event with a time of 8:22.67
  • Won the men’s steeplechase national quarterfinal at the NCAA East First Rounds with an 8:24.91 mark
  • Finished fifth in both the national semifinal and final at the NCAA Championships in Eugene
  • Placed second at the Tom Jones Invitational with a personal best time of 3:42.63
  • Finished fifth in the steeplechase event at the Jim Green Invitational with a time of 3:43.65

Prior to UK

  • Represented Kenya and placed 5th in the 3000m steeplechase at the 2024 African Championships
  • Placed 2nd in the 3000m steeplechase at the 2024 Kenyan Championships
